Freeze / Crash with Brave and Discord (25.3.1)

Updated to 25.3.1 yesterday and ever since, if I have the Brave browser open in the background and I open up Discord, my PC will completely freeze or crash.

This does not happen with previous drivers, also tested with different browsers and did a memory test just to make sure.

Also, this seems to happen only when I have Twitch open, tried other website but it didn't happen. Maybe it can happen with Youtube but I don't want to destroy my PC.

 

Edit: It happened right now with both already open

I've had similar issues with my 5700 XT on 25.3.1 when having chrome open on one of my monitors (which is always). I suspect the cause is either hardware acceleration or windows overriding the adrenaline drivers. I'm not going to tempt fate to find out which is the true cause.

 

Specifically, I'll at some point have a sudden freeze, followed both monitors going black. This was then followed by a couple of minutes of intermittent sound bites from whatever video (if any) was playing at the time, and the backlights of my monitors turning on and off a few times before my system seemingly gives up trying to get my GPU going and my 9800X3D's iGPU takes over. Sometimes, but not always, I found that the 5700 XT got disabled in device manager after this. I've put the report through adrenaline's reporter every time, but frankly, I never figured it might be a hardware acceleration issue until a couple of days ago. I just described what I was doing at the time the issue occured.

 

I've since rolled back to 25.2.1 (though it autoupdated back to 25.3.1; very cool), disabled automatic windows side driver updates and turned off graphics acceleration in chrome. So far so good, but I'm still crossing my fingers and hoping for the best.

 

25.3.2 notes specifically mention fixing windows overriding adrenaline drivers on the 9070 series cards, but I wonder if that fix helps the older cards as well? I didn't notice a mention about hardware acceleration issues in them.
